Output 0c53852df3d1090439d76bb385d7d85669892f45b9d2b31a6610d22edb84910c:1

value
659917233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21e46a6f278b3f5a5d99fc2b3ecefe8c0b77664 OP_EQUAL
address
MRbZbFtpUyKwFMvjEnLEHkVT2FQDGcdXoy
transaction
0c53852df3d1090439d76bb385d7d85669892f45b9d2b31a6610d22edb84910c
spent
true